RIYADH, December 25 (Saudi Arabia Breaking News) – The falconry section at the Northern Borders Region’s pavilion attracted strong visitor interest at an exhibition organised by the Ministry of Interior, with attendees gathering to view the falcons and learn about the region’s cultural heritage.
Visitors were seen taking commemorative photographs with the falcons on display and engaging with information presented on falconry traditions, which hold a longstanding place in northern Saudi Arabia.
Organisers said the section has emerged as one of the pavilion’s main attractions due to falconry’s cultural and historical significance, with falcons regarded as a key symbol of identity in the Northern Borders Region.
The falconry section forms part of the Northern Borders Region’s participation in the exhibition, aimed at offering visitors an interactive experience that highlights local heritage and reinforces national identity through the presentation of traditional practices.
